1. Home /
  2. Company /
  3. EfinixInc

Category



General Information

Locality: Santa Clara, California



Address: 900 Lafayette St, Suite 406 95050 Santa Clara, CA, US

Website: www.efinixinc.com/

Likes: 16

Reviews

Add review

Facebook Blog